Here is each degree level granted in general sales & marketing at Long Beach City College, along with how many graduates complete each level annually.
| Degree Level | Annual Graduates |
|---|---|
| Associate’s | 14 |
| Certificate | 14 |
For the most recent IPEDS reporting year, Long Beach City College awarded 14 associate’s degrees in general sales & marketing.
Long Beach City College is not yet ranked for general sales & marketing at the associate’s level.
Average full-time tuition and fees are listed in the table below.
| In State | Out of State | |
|---|---|---|
| Tuition | $1,472 | $12,460 |
| Fees | $84 | $84 |

Among recent graduates, 29% of general sales & marketing associate’s degrees went to men and 71% went to women.
The largest share of general sales & marketing associate’s degree graduates at Long Beach City College were Hispanic or Latino. Roughly 64% of graduates fell into this category.
The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Long Beach City College with a associate’s in general sales & marketing.
| Ethnic Background | Number of Students |
|---|---|
| Asian | 1 |
| Black or African American | 1 |
| Hispanic or Latino | 9 |
| White | 1 |
| Non-Resident Aliens | 0 |
| Other Races | 2 |

During the most recent reporting year, Long Beach City College awarded 14 certificate degrees in general sales & marketing.
Long Beach City College has not been ranked for general sales & marketing at the certificate level.
In the most recent graduating class, 36% of general sales & marketing certificate degrees went to men and 64% went to women.
The majority of general sales & marketing certificate degree graduates at Long Beach City College are Hispanic or Latino. About 71% of graduates fell into this category.
The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Long Beach City College with a certificate in general sales & marketing.
| Ethnic Background | Number of Students |
|---|---|
| Asian | 1 |
| Black or African American | 0 |
| Hispanic or Latino | 10 |
| White | 3 |
| Non-Resident Aliens | 0 |
| Other Races | 0 |
